Hell Found Me

Hell found me desirable
And all the world took a back seat.
The sun no longer creased the sky,
No flowers or trees bloomed beneath.
Oceans swelling higher, began their recede,
and life spinning on it's axis began to cease.

Clouds covered the heavens.
The stars once out of reach,
fell to the mountain tops
lighting the steps which descend to that deep
Red hot darkness, blue black at it's peak.

Not horned or menacing,
as folklore once had speak.
Hell had found me desirable
But my lord said " Come she is Heavens to keep."

We

I think of the years between us and 
Little snippets of our journey floods my mind.
Life and all it's roads at times difficult

Allowing us the chance to change, to be remade for the
Last of all our tales shall be of our triumphs- 
Ways we conquered our self doubt, our impulses
Always giving way to that better me, better you
Yet you walk these roads with a heavy heart
Soul weary and feet blistered and I say to you

Be not afraid of what s to come
Everyone is given only what he or she can bear

Yes I say to it all - the pain, our tears, the laughter
Our fears,  - the joy and all these years between us
Underneath it all there lies our blessing and 
Redemption in the form of this friendship

For the mistakes, the errs are not erased but" Our Father In Heaven"
Remember is the sweetest prayer
In it we find the mercy he tempers our punishment
Even as we are wrong, we are in his light
No man can take your soul, so walk
Don't run to the end of your life, when it is done, he is there.
